About 2001 Dodge Stratus II

The Dodge Stratus II, produced from 2001 to 2006, is a mid-size sedan that offers a balanced combination of size, comfort, and practicality. With a length ranging between 4724 mm and 4856 mm (186 to 191 inches), the Stratus II presents a robust stance on the road while remaining maneuverable in urban environments. Its width varies from 1793 mm to 1821 mm (70.5 to 71.7 inches), providing a spacious cabin without compromising agility. The vehicle's height is between 1377 mm and 1395 mm (54.2 to 54.9 inches), contributing to a low and aerodynamic profile typical of sedans in this segment.

Weight-wise, the Stratus II comes with a curb weight spanning from 1334 kg up to 1510 kg (approximately 2943 to 3329 lbs), depending on trim and equipment, ensuring a stable yet responsive driving experience. The maximum allowable weight for the vehicle is rated at 1990 kg (4387 lbs). This model is equipped to accommodate tire sizes ranging from 195/70 R14, 195/65 R15, to 205/60 R16, paired with rim sizes of 14 and 15 inches that contribute to its road handling capabilities.

In terms of practicality, the Dodge Stratus II offers a luggage capacity between 445 liters and 454 liters (about 15.7 to 16 cubic feet), providing ample space for everyday luggage and groceries. Engine Options

The 2001 Dodge Stratus II comes with a choice of inline-4 and V6 engines, including a 2.4L 4-cylinder engine producing around 150 horsepower and a more powerful 2.7L V6 engine delivering approximately 200 horsepower.

Transmission

It offers both a 5-speed manual transmission and a 4-speed automatic transmission, providing versatility for different driving preferences.

Safety Features

Equipped with dual front airbags, anti-lock brakes (ABS) on V6 models, and available side airbags, the Stratus II emphasizes occupant protection.

Interior Comfort

The sedan features a spacious cabin with comfortable seating, available leather upholstery, and dual-zone climate control for enhanced passenger comfort.

Handling and Suspension

With independent front suspension and a multi-link rear suspension, the 2001 Dodge Stratus II delivers stable handling and a smooth ride quality.

The Dodge Stratus II, compared to its predecessor (the first-generation Stratus), generally became slightly larger in overall dimensions. This generation was lengthened, widened, and given a slightly lower profile for improved aerodynamics and interior space. The second generation provided enhanced passenger comfort with more cabin room and trunk space, marking a clear evolution toward a more modern midsize sedan.

The Dodge Stratus II was competitive in size with other midsize sedans from the early 2000s. Its length of up to 4856 mm (191.1 inches) and width up to 1821 mm (71.7 inches) aligned closely with models such as the Toyota Camry, Honda Accord, and Ford Taurus. It offered slightly more width and trunk space than some rivals, providing a spacious feel while maintaining maneuverability in urban environments.
